Output e7e643d99ff258a86eb793fa0e93577a280f57d505cd3cbfb30a84f46f33efe0:2

value
138771660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1cfc83ac1f31ad37d4d7a11eb6b1c73fbd14cb OP_EQUAL
address
MU9ay2T7ZtXneR9wntVSZ2xnbji1Amf5pc
transaction
e7e643d99ff258a86eb793fa0e93577a280f57d505cd3cbfb30a84f46f33efe0
spent
true